What is ADHD?
ADHD is a neurodevelopmental disorder characterized by patterns of inattention, hyperactivity, and impulsiveness. While lots of think it mostly affects children, studies reveal that ADHD persists into adulthood for around 60% of those detected in childhood.

2. Hyperactivity
While hyperactive symptoms may decrease with age, many adults still experience a sense of uneasyness or a requirement to be constantly hectic. This restlessness can manifest as a failure to relax or sit still during conferences or in social situations.
3. Impulsivity
Impulsivity can result in risky behavior and poor decision-making, impacting various facets of life, including financial and professional choices. Adults might interrupt conversations or battle with patience.
4. Emotional Dysregulation
Emotional outbursts or mood swings prevail, creating challenges in personal relationships and office characteristics. Adults may discover it hard to manage stress or frustration.
5. Chronic Disorganization
Adults with ADHD typically fight with time management and organization, which can result in efficiency problems at work. This lack of organization can exacerbate sensations of insufficiency and tension.
